Hurricane Sandy Donations Collected at Verona Football Game

The Verona Policeman's Benevolent Association will be collecting items for Hurricane Sandy victims during today's Verona Football game

 

The Verona Policeman’s Benevolent Association (PBA) Local 72 will be collecting items for Hurricane Sandy victims during today's Verona Football game against Newark's East Side High School.

The PBA is looking for canned foods, personal hygiene products, diapers, pet food, sternos, cleaning supplies and AA and D batteries to be distributed to Hurricane Sandy victims with the help of Goman's Delivery Service.

"Please limit donated items to what has been specifically requested by the victims," they said.

Collections will run during the game from 11 a.m. until 2 p.m. at Verona High School.

"Thank you in advance for your cooperation and assistance," the PBA said.

Other items include:

  • coffee cups
  • ground coffee
  • paper plates
  • work gloves
  • hot dog & hamburger rolls
  • duct tape
  • respirator masks
  • cleaning supplies
  • dried pastas
  • instant potato
  • prepackaged sliced cheese
  • bacon
  • breakfast sausages
  • eggs
  • warm gloves
